stationary fireballs seen in sky south of interstate 8 and west of Gila Bend about 20min

6/27/12 10:23pm Driving Eastbound on interstate 8, about mile market 95, 20 min West of Gila Bend. My sister and I spot the lights south of the highway.

First one light that looks like a fireball which has a smoke trail rising. Then that fireball emits 3 smaller fireballs like an explosion/firework but it doesn’t look like a firework. They dissipate and another fireball, the same size as the first, lights up not too far from the first. The first goes out and then lights up again after about 5 min. I took some video but it is very shaky because we did not stop the car. The fireballs stay stationary in the sky and are too high to be burning off a tower like a gas release at a dump. But that is what I thought at first. I have been reading others accounts of a similar sighting in the same spot, which makes me believe it has a reasonable explanation that no one has cared to investigate. I know I haven’t.

The most reasonable seems to be related to some air base that, I have read, is in the area. Not sure what it would be but it is probably related to that. I am curious but not curious enough to drive back there.
